Abstract
⺠Cold enzymatic hydrolysis conditions for ethanol production were optimized. ⺠The optimum conditions were obtained by response surface methodology. ⺠The multi-objectives optimizations were obtained by weighted coefficient methods. ⺠The optimized conditions were feasible and reliable through verification tests.
